LJS taught me 2 things I've carried over into non-fast-food:

1 - beer batter (or batter in general) is significantly superior to breading when it comes to fried food

2- malt vinegar is a must for me for fried fish or seafood (I'm surprised it's not a more popular condiment in the Midwest and South where I grew up, though it does seem more popular now than it was 30 years ago, when I actually went to LJS with any regularity). I avoided fried fish for years because I can't stand tartar sauce, but liked fried seafood because I like cocktail sauce. Malt vinegar opened my eyes to fried fish.
